- Core Data Platform member building ingestion and streaming systems for fStream.
- Architected Kafka and GCP Pub/Sub REST APIs processing terabytes of data daily.
- Led transition to real-time processing for ML and analytics workloads.
- Redesigned fStream using Apache Beam and Apache Flink.
- Built fault-tolerant MongoDB and MySQL CDC streaming solutions.
- Mapped 40k+ assets with full lineage through DataHub cataloging.
Senior Software Engineer
Parth Tiwari
Distributed systems engineer with 7+ years of experience in real-time data pipelines, high-throughput backend services, and large-scale platform infrastructure.
Experience
Backend, streaming, and data platform work.
- Led B2B Flights backend development using Golang and Java.
- Optimized flight search APIs with SSE, gRPC, and RxJava for 1M+ daily searches.
- Decomposed a Java monolith into Search, Booking, and Ancillary microservices.
- Reduced round-trip search load by 2-3s and one-way search load by 0.5s.
- Integrated Amazon Flights and scaled the platform to 39,000+ SMEs and 6,300+ corporates.
- Unified MakeMyTrip and Goibibo bus backends into a shared service and database.
- Built ad-tech reports for B2C bus services using Kafka and MongoDB, handling 5M daily updates.
- Built NEO-Sales Assist module integrating credit bureau and PAN validation systems.
- Developed backend components for employment, income, address, and OTP verification.
- Engineered core loan application REST APIs using Spring and Hibernate MVC.
Technical Skills
Tools for reliable backend systems.
Hands-on across service design, stream processing, data cataloging, cloud infrastructure, observability, and production-grade delivery.
Languages
Backend & Streaming
Data, Cloud & DevOps
Education & Achievements
Competitive programming roots and engineering foundation.
B.Tech, ECE
IIIT Delhi | 2015 - 2019
ACM-ICPC 2019
Rank 183 out of 3,890 participants.
Google Kickstart 2020
Round G rank 116 out of 8,050 participants.
Teaching & Social Work
Teaching Assistant for Competitive Programming. Social Welfare Intern teaching Mathematics at CRY.
Contact
Let's talk backend systems, data platforms, and scale.
Available for engineering conversations around distributed systems, data infrastructure, and high-throughput backend platforms.